Wheat paste (often known as flour paste) is really a gel or liquid adhesive created from combining wheat flour or starch with drinking water. Lots of street artists use wheat paste to adhere paper posters to walls. Much like stencils, wheat paste posters are preferable for street artists since it permits them to accomplish most of the preparing at your house or in the studio, with only some moments essential at the website of set up, pasting the poster to the desired surface area.

Called Afghanistan’s very first feminine graffiti artist, Hassani, born in 1988, normally would make her artwork on bombed or abandoned structures. A flexible artist, equally relaxed having a can or even a brush, she teaches at Kabul University and in 2013 Established the Kabul Graffiti Competition.

During the nineties the hand painted posters began to get replaced by flex banners outdoors theatres. Following the 2000s, the recognition of street posters started to decline, remaining replaced by digitally printed posters. Street artwork painting and street art drawing sketch has because declined in India because of the substitution by digital posters.
